ZachXBT Recommends Dedicated iPhone Amid Controversy Over Cryptocurrency Wallet Security
Controversy Over the Security and Usability of Hardware Wallets
On-chain investigator ZachXBT criticized hardware wallets for being unsuitable for storing cryptocurrencies and signing important transactions, recommending instead the use of a dedicated iPhone for such purposes.
In response, rebuttals and alternatives have been presented by Trezor, wallet developers, and security professionals, sparking a debate over the most suitable methods for self-managing cryptocurrencies.
ZachXBT Raises Usability Concerns and Advocates for a Dedicated iPhone
On Thursday, July 16, 2026, ZachXBT posted on Telegram, asserting that hardware wallets are "completely useless" for critical functions such as signing transactions and storing funds. He suggested that it would be better to prepare a dedicated iPhone solely for cryptocurrency-related activities.
His criticism was primarily directed at Ledger, highlighting issues with frequent UI changes due to updates in Ledger Live and interruptions in basic operations. He also pointed out that in situations requiring urgent high-value transactions, problems such as battery depletion, mandatory upgrades for devices or software, and site malfunctions that hinder signing multi-signature transactions could pose significant obstacles.
On the other hand, ZachXBT did not state that a new breach had occurred at Ledger, nor did he provide evidence indicating that private keys had recently been leaked. Regarding the dedicated iPhone, it was suggested that avoiding browsing, messaging, and the use of unrelated apps could potentially reduce exposure to malicious links and compromised software.
Trezor Points Out the Broader Attack Surface
Danny Sanders, Chief Commercial Officer of Trezor, countered that smartphones have a broader potential attack surface due to features like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, cellular connections, and iMessage, compared to hardware wallets.
